2019-2020 Innovation of the Year Award Winner: Carroll Community College

Digital Design and Fabrication A.A.S. and Certificate Program

Digital fabrication will revolutionize how we invent and create, and change the way we design and bring to market new products for all time. A wider adoption of the training and technology surrounding digital fabrication is inevitable; we need to ensure that the workforce is prepared to respond. The COVID-19 pandemic is showing its importance as 3D printers are being used to produce critical medical supplies such as face shields and ventilators. The creation of the Digital Design and Fabrication program yielded the design, approval, and implementation of a distinctive pathway and state-of-the-art digital fabrication training facility/lab. The result is a unique program that integrates design-object literacy, problem-solving strategies, entrepreneurship, and advanced manufacturing technology. This program is unparalleled in that students will leverage contemporary fabrication tools, coupled with design thinking and problem solving, not only to solve manufacturing problems, but to engage broader issues.
